Transaction 584e205c7b2a4a62c8c58f2be41df3631952065a12c60f356ee65143f8344b6d

27 Input
2 Outputs
  • 584e205c7b2a4a62c8c58f2be41df3631952065a12c60f356ee65143f8344b6d:0
  • value  85834
    address  38EBZFiUUyNkUehSLRFnLXjmQxgtrqABFd
  • 584e205c7b2a4a62c8c58f2be41df3631952065a12c60f356ee65143f8344b6d:1
  • value  21239390
    address  1PCHszrGHevWXbH3Ut9hcHHF68D95MxRJm